Overview

Summary:The Senior Talent Acquisition Specialist is responsible for all recruiting activities related to the attraction, selection, hiring and on-boarding of talent to ensure we are building teams with the critical skills needed to move the business forward. Considerable skill in interviewing techniques, good knowledge of the company and of personnel policy and procedure and federal and state laws regarding employment practices are essential.

 

The Senior Talent Acquisition Specialist analyzes the information provided on a prospective employee's application form, conducts interviews and determines the suitability of the applicant for employment. This position acts as a mentor to Talent Acquisition Specialists and supports the Talent Acquisition Director.

About Reliant Rehabilitation

Founded in 2001, Reliant is a leading provider of rehabilitation management services (physical, occupational and speech therapy) to skilled nursing facilities across the United States. Reliant has approximately 9,000 employees who currently serve more than 800 facilities in 40 states.
